Thursday, April 1, 2010

Cu 11.3% mai multi useri

Am redus consumul de memorie cu inca 11.3% ... asta inseamna ca pe resursele hardware pe care puteam tine 100 de useri, ducem acum 111. O reducere de memorie de inca 15% m-ar multumi pentru moment, dar nu am nici cea mai mica idee de unde.

Ca sa-ti faci o idee, Concept IDE consuma acum pe server (fara proiect deschis) 9.5 MB RAM.

Am testat foarte mult cu Memory Validator - o unealta excelenta - din toate uneltele de memory analysis pe care le-am testat, acceasta mi s-a parut cea mai utila. Probleme mari nu au fost gasite (eu fiind mandru de asta).

Am filtrat si warning-urile (fiind excesiv de multe). Acum, pe o aplicatie de test pe care se generau aproximativ 5800 de warning-uri, se genereaza acum 235 relevante. Iti dai seama ca la 5800 nu le-ar fi luat nimeni in serios ...

Pe GyroGears - multe lucruri noi si mult debugging - au fost corectate niste bug-uri legate de butonul ce apare pe formurile child pentru referire la parinti (daca se apasa pe acel buton, din copil, se mergea pe parinte si se faceau operatiuni de add/modify pe relatii se ajungea la invalidarea tranzactiei).

S-au adaugat membri "read-only". Acum orice membru poate fi definit ca read-only, indiferent de tipul lor.

Am inceput lucrul la noul site (sper sa si reusesc sa-l si termin).

2 comments:

Mihai Oltean said...

ce inseamna 0.3% dintr-un user ?
e vorba de o femeie ?

Bogo said...

e vreo pacaleala de 1 aprilie postul? :P